Chembai is a Malayalam toponymic name from Kerala, India, deriving from the village of Chembai in Palakkad district. As a place-derived personal name, its semantic sense is “from Chembai” rather than a discrete lexical meaning. The underlying toponym’s etymology is uncertain; a common folk link associates Chembai with Malayalam chembu “copper,” evoking a coppery/red hue, but this is not firmly established.
The name gained widespread recognition through the 20th-century Carnatic maestro Chembai Vaidyanatha Bhagavatar, after whom the annual Chembai Sangeetholsavam is named. Because of that legacy, Chembai is occasionally adopted as a given name or honorific, chiefly among Malayali families, and tends to read masculine in use, though as a locative it is technically unisex. Variant transliterations include Chembayi and Chempai; spelling follows Malayalam-to-English conventions. Related forms appear as surnames or sobriquets indicating origin from the village.
